The Danish international, a free agent since leaving United in June, has followed his former توتنهام team-mate Harry Kane to the الدوري الألماني. The 33-year-old, who previously starred for Spurs and انتر, had been heavily linked with باير ليفركوزن, especially following the arrival of Kasper Hjulmand, his former الدنمارك coach.
For Eriksen, this move represents a fresh chapter, from hisnear-fatal cardiac arrest at Euro 2020 to his inspirational return at برينتفورد and United, the playmaker has consistently defied the odds. Joining Wolfsburg marks his first-ever spell in German football, a league renowned for its tactical intensity and physical demands.
Reports in Germany suggested that Leverkusen were frontrunners for Eriksen, with Hjulmand keen to reunite with his trusted playmaker. English media outlets even hinted that a Leverkusen deal was close. However, Wolfsburg acted quickly, arranging travel from Odense to Braunschweig for Eriksen to secure the midfielder. Eriksen has been maintaining fitness with Malmo in السويد following his United exit. His form at Old Trafford last season showed flashes of quality, as he netted five goals and made six assists in 35 appearances.
For Wolfsburg, Eriksen’s arrival not only boosts their midfield options but also raises their profile in the Bundesliga. It remains to be seen if he is thrown into the mix when the German side host Koln on Saturday.
